Understanding Subcontractor Contracts
As working with contractors, a strong understanding of contracts is essential for safeguarding your investment and ensuring that the project runs seamlessly. Contractor contracts generally define the scope of tasks, deadlines, payment schedules, and requirements from all parties. Acquainting yourself with these components can prevent conflicts and disputes down the road.
Selecting the best contractor, whether a general contractor in Boston or a specialized siding contractor in Boston MA, requires careful examination of the contract terms. Notice specifics such as the resources to be used, the specific work to be completed, and any warranties included. These details not only define the project's course but also hold contractors responsible for delivering on their promises.
Finally, it’s important to know the provisions that might affect your project. This entails amendments, which allow for changes to the work agreed upon, and termination provisions, which lay out the conditions under which a contract can be ended. Understanding how to navigate these elements of contracts with home contractors in Boston or kitchen renovation specialists can significantly improve your experience and outcomes.

Frequently Encountered Legal Provisions
One important aspect of contractor agreements is the definition of services clause. This clause clearly defines the particular responsibilities the contractor, such as construction professionals in Boston, is expected to fulfilling. It is crucial for homeowners to understand exactly what is covered in the project to prevent any confusion later. A well-defined definition helps ensure that both parties are on the same page, particularly when it comes to home additions or renovations.
Another key clause is the payment terms. This part details how and when the contractor will be compensated, which is particularly important for construction companies in the Boston area or siding contractors in Massachusetts. Payment schedules can vary, but they commonly include initial deposits, interim payments, and completion payments when work completion. Property owners should verify that this clause aligns with their budgeting and provides enough security for both sides.
Lastly, the agreement should include a termination provision. This clause outlines the circumstances under which either party can terminate the agreement and the consequences of such actions. Understanding this provision is essential, as it protects property owners and service providers alike in the event of unexpected circumstances. If it concerns a hold-up in building or modifications in work scope, having a clear termination provision can offer peace of mind throughout the project.
